Dublin 0-16 Kilkenny 0-138 minutes agoSeán Moran gives us his reaction to the first half, as the second begins:"A big crowd in Parnell Park on a summer’s day have watched Dublin avail of a slight wind to lead Kilkenny by four at half-time, 0-15 to 0-11. The home side are worth the margin but may regret 11 wides, several of which should have been converted. Late replacement John Hetherton caused early havoc winning his signature high ball and converting for two points after Kilkenny had started well.Defence however is where Dublin have delivered most impressively given the absence from the team of late withdrawals, Eoghan O’Donnell and Liam Rushe. Paddy Smyth has played well on TJ Reid and in general, the team are well competitive on breaking ball and rucks.A couple of goal chances came to nothing as Reid was forced into taking a point after the ball spilled loose and Eddie Gibbons saved from Harry Shine at the expense of a converted 65.Dónal Burke’s frees have been nearly flawless – one wide – and Brian Hayes’s pace has troubled Kilkenny. With the news from Wexford potentially shaking up things, there is the prospect of these two teams qualifying for the Leinster final should Kilkenny win and Galway lose."21 minutes agoSo the Joe McDonagh Cup final will be contested between local rivals Laois and Carlow.
